Soma Compilation 2007

Soma Compilation 2007

Various Artists [Soma Recordings]

Soma’s Glaswegian operation is one of techno’s key fortresses.

Names like Alex Smoke or Funk D’Void are some of the sound’s biggest artists as a result of the eagle eye label bosses Slam have spied on the scene over the years (and let’s not forget that without them we wouldn’t have Daft Punk either, who signed with Soma to release their groundbreaking debut, ‘Homework’, in 1997).

This year the label yields another impressive crop of releases, and its no surprise that Slam turn in our favourite track from them in 2007.

Azure is big room melodic end of night techno that reaffirms Stuart and Order as two of the scene’s biggest players (and while you’re at it, check out the excellent Radio Slave and Samuel L. Sessions remixes).

Alex Smoke delivers the minimallist’s favourite remixing The Unknown Wanderer ‘Don’t Start Just Finish It.’

It’s typically Smoke — a mix of futuristic melodies and classic techno beats.

Silicone Soul’s ‘3AM’ is classic Soma sounding techno melody, while veteran producers The Black Dog add to that blueprint with ‘Cost II’.

Lee Van Dowski adds to the tension with the ‘The Strike Pandemonium,’ an ever-building percussive techno workout.

Funk D’Void adds the deep house touch with the Your Body Mix of ‘Lovin’, while Vector Lovers showcase Soma’s electro tastes with ‘A Field’ and their remix of My Robot Friend’s ‘Rapture.’
